BUYER BEWARE!!!!!! I bought a car from Route 69 Auto Sales in the middle of Sept. 2014. Out of the first 44 days of owning this car, they had it for 26 days. I would be told "it will take 2 days to fix" and then I wouldn't get it back for 6 days. They never returned phone calls, they were rude, they acted like it was my fault for the car having issues.
These were minor issues in the big scheme of things. The car had a 30 day warranty. So when the check engine light came on, I had it scanned and was told it was the catalytic converter, I took the car right back to Route 69 Auto Sales. They also agreed it was the catalytic converter and agreed to replace it. They had the car for 6 days. Finally, after numerous other things being wrong, I thought I was done with this business.
In February, I took the car in for emissions. Lo and behold, the car failed due to the catalytic converter and a non-working check engine light. I took the car to a mechanic other than Route 69 Auto Sales to check 1) had the catalytic converter been changed within the last 6 months and 2) why wasn't the check engine light working. Here's the results: 1) the catalytic converter was the factory original and 2) the check engine light (behind the dash) had been "punctured and disabled". Route 69 did agree to replace the catalytic converter, but said "We've already gone above and beyond for you and we're not going to get into changing the bulb."
Thank God I had been documenting everything (even though Route 69 never gave any kind of paperwork for the repairs they did) and I filed a complaint with the Department of Motor Vehicles. DMV was wonderful and they were able to get Route 69 Auto Sales to replace the check engine light bulb (which would have cost me $1500.00 at the [redacted] dealer) so my car was able to pass through emissions. Route 69 Auto Sales is so disrespectful that when I went to pick up my car, the hood was covered in motor oil and they acted like it was my fault when I asked them to clean it up.
Beware of websites where all the reviews are positive. On some sites the dealers are able to manipulate the reviews and add lots of positive reviews. Please learn from my mistake and do your own research into this company. Lastly, when I dropped the car off to have the bulb replaced, Mike L. said to me "let's get one thing clear, if I see anymore negative reviews online, I will not finish working on your car". So now that my car has passed emissions, I'm able to post my experiences with Route 69 Auto Sales. whose legal name is [redacted]. dba Route 69 Auto.

Review: When we decided to buy the 2003 [redacted], we gave rt 69 auto sales a $250 deposit, which we did on our debit card. We secured a loan through our bank ([redacted]) and my wife went back to write a check for the remainder of the $4800 we purchased the van for with a bankcheck from [redacted]. She asked if she could write the check out for the full $4800 and have our checking credited for the $250 deposit. [redacted] said it would be fine but since I wasn't present, just my wife went to get the van, he would need me to sign some documents, mail them back, and they would then credit our account. I signed the papers and mailed them back. When my wife contacted them about recieving the paperwork, they acknowldeged they received it but had no recollection of the $250 deposit. Now they are asking for us to fax them the sales receipt, something they already have a copy of.

This is the only complaint I am filing, but I am going to add that 3 days after puchase we had to bring the van back for an oil leak and no working headlights. How could a safety inspection have taken place with no working headlights. I also had to replace the front brake pads within 45 days. I really don't think they did any inspection.

I have documentation through my checking account statement and a copy of the check my wife wrote that we have paid rt 69 $5050 and a copy of the sales receipt stating we agreed on $4800 total for the van. Instead of jumping through hoops for them, I am filing a complaint with you.Desired Settlement: All I want is my checking account to be credited the $250.
